Nghe An female student passionate about STEM receives scholarships from 8 American universities

Báo Kinh tế và Đô thịBáo Kinh tế và Đô thị12/03/2025


With outstanding academic achievements and impressive essays, Tu Uyen conquered the strict judges and received scholarships from famous schools in the US such as Knox College (worth 204,000 USD), Texas Christian University (worth 213,000 USD), Depauw University (worth 176,000 USD),...

In addition, Uyen also received an acceptance letter from Purdue University, a long-standing and famous school for training in aerospace technology. According to QS World University Ranking 2025, Purdue University is ranked 89th in the world with only 20% of international students, a pioneer in the US in promoting the participation of women in the field of science and technology.

Some of Tu Uyen's outstanding achievements include: winning a 60% scholarship from TH School; achieving 3 A's (the highest score) in biology, mathematics and business in the AS Level exam; being a member of the "Hear Us Now" project supporting programming teaching for hearing-impaired students.

According to Tu Uyen, her high school years had a great influence on her achievements and development orientation. In grade 10, Uyen passed the entrance exam to a prestigious specialized school in Nghe An. However, the desire to experience an international learning environment was always cherished in Uyen - where Uyen had the opportunity to liberate herself, highlight her own identity as well as open the door to studying abroad with a prestigious scholarship.

During an academic competition organized by TH School Vinh, experiencing the "For True Happiness" environment as well as learning about the Cambridge AS & A Levels program, Tu Uyen realized that this was the model of the high school she had always longed for.

Uyen put her struggles when deciding to leave her comfort zone into her essay, helping the female student receive acceptance letters from 11 schools.

For Uyen, leaving a long-standing prestigious public school to move to a completely different international environment was extremely risky and daring. In addition, with the requirement to study and take exams entirely in English according to international standards, each individual must make a great effort to be able to keep up with the new curriculum.

“Weighing the pros and cons before deciding to transfer took up a lot of my time, and I overcame my fear. The fear of missing out on an opportunity that I might regret later outweighed all the risks,” Uyen shared in her essay.

In the eyes of teachers and friends, Tu Uyen is a "superheroine" who dares to think, dares to do, and dares to experience. (Photo: Nhat Minh)

The family discussions lasted for weeks. Finally, realizing their daughter's determination and clear study plan, Tu Uyen's parents supported her decision.

“I used to be afraid of social interactions, but now I can confidently stand in front of a crowd. I have learned to think more carefully about relationships and how to treat myself. Before, there were times when I avoided homework. Now, I have found joy in learning and exploring, whether alone or with others. My achievements may not be the highest, but my confidence has increased a lot. I have begun to believe that inner courage and determination can be a reliable source of motivation and shape who I am” - Tu Uyen expressed her thoughts about the learning process in a new environment in her essay.

Tu Uyen’s choice of major not only demonstrates an effective career orientation strategy, but also aims to eliminate gender stereotypes and affirm the role and capacity of women in the STEM field. The event of passing the admission round of Purdue University has further motivated Uyen to make the final decision. In the context of a developing world and a narrowing gender gap, Uyen believes that engineering - a major that was popular with men in the past - will welcome many influential female leaders.

In the future, Tu Uyen hopes to work in a field that combines engineering and technology, such as Artificial Intelligence, Automation or Software Engineering.

“I believe that advances in these fields will shape the future, and I want to be a part of that development. Besides, I am also very interested in issues related to medicine and biology, so I am learning more about how to apply engineering to develop solutions in these fields,” Uyen confided.
